PHP+MySQL实现的学生选课系统设计

0 下载量 195 浏览量 更新于2024-06-23 收藏 1.83MB DOC 举报
"基于PHP+MySQL的学生选课信息系统是一篇大学生毕业论文,作者张维丹,指导教师权双燕。该系统旨在利用互联网技术解决日益增长的教务数据管理问题,采用B/S模式,前端使用Bootstrap框架,后端数据库为MySQL,服务器软件是Apache。系统支持管理员、教师和学生的在线操作,包括信息管理、选课和查看课表等功能。" 这篇论文设计了一个基于PHP和MySQL的网上学生选课系统,以适应高等教育中教务管理的需求。随着大学在校生数量的不断增长,传统的选课方式可能无法有效处理大量的数据,因此,利用先进的互联网技术开发这样的系统显得尤为重要。 系统采用了B/S(Browser/Server)架构,即浏览器/服务器模式,这意味着用户可以通过Web浏览器进行操作,降低了用户端的系统需求,提升了系统的可访问性和便捷性。在技术实现上,前端界面利用Bootstrap框架,这是一款流行的响应式设计工具,可以确保网站在不同设备上具有良好的用户体验。后端数据库选择了MySQL,因其开源、稳定且性能优秀,适合处理大量数据。服务器软件选择Apache,作为广泛应用的Web服务器,它提供了稳定和高效的环境来运行PHP代码。 系统的主要功能包括以下几个方面: 1. **管理员管理**:管理员可以在线管理用户,包括管理员、教师和学生的信息,如添加、删除和修改用户资料。 2. **课程与教室管理**:管理员可以维护课程信息和教室资源,确保选课过程的顺利进行。 3. **教师功能**:教师可以在系统中查看自己的课程安排,以及已经选修他们课程的学生名单,方便教学管理和沟通。 4. **学生选课**:学生能够通过系统在线选课,查看课程介绍和时间表,根据自己的需求选择合适的课程。 5. **数据安全性**:系统应具备一定的安全措施,保护用户数据不被非法访问或篡改。 论文中,作者可能会深入探讨这些功能的具体实现,包括PHP编程技巧、MySQL数据库设计、表结构优化以及如何使用Apache配置和部署Web应用。此外,还会涉及系统测试、性能评估和可能的改进方向等内容。 关键词如“学生选课系统”、“PHP”、“MYSQL”和“B/S模式”揭示了研究的核心内容,即使用PHP语言和MySQL数据库构建的B/S架构学生选课系统,这在当前教育信息化背景下具有重要的实践意义和研究价值。